Algerian Soudani’s late strike keeps Maribor in title race

Inbound6702811536260403991 768x576 1

Hillal Soudani reaffirmed his enduring value to NK Maribor with a decisive goal that secured a crucial victory over NK Olimpija Ljubljana.

The 37-year-old Algerian forward struck in the 77th minute, delivering a 1-0 triumph that significantly narrowed the gap in the league standings to just three points.

Soudani’s moment of brilliance came at a pivotal stage of the match, demonstrating his continued sharpness and experience.

With both sides locked in a tense contest, his precise finish proved to be the difference, keeping Maribor firmly in the title chase.

After the match, Soudani expressed his gratitude to the club’s supporters, highlighting their role in the team’s success. Speaking to the media outlet Planetnogomet, he said: “I want to thank our fans who created an incredible atmosphere.

I also congratulate my teammates, with whom we managed to win this very important match. I believe our victory was well deserved, but most importantly, we have now cut the gap with Olimpija to just three points.”

The win not only bolsters Maribor’s championship ambitions but also underlines Soudani’s enduring influence on the pitch.

Despite his age, the veteran Algerian striker continues to deliver when it matters most, reinforcing his reputation as a key figure in Maribor’s squad.

As the season progresses, his experience and leadership could prove vital in the club’s pursuit of silverware.

With the title race heating up, Maribor will look to build on this momentum, and Soudani remains determined to play a central role in their campaign.
